On the weekend of the 27th and 28th of July, His Eminence, Metropolitan Basilios travelled to Adelaide to visit the local community of St Elias Antiochian Orthodox Church. He was received by Fr. Nicholas Haddad, along with other clergy and faithful.
During his stay, Metropolitan Basilios met with the parish council, ladies auxiliary, and youth of the community and offered pastoral guidance and support. He assured the community that they remain in his prayers and thoughts and that he is proud of their achievements thus far in the South Australian city. He continued by offering boundless words of encouragement in the hope that the community would continue striving for the Glory of God to the best of their ability.
A great emphasis was placed on education, especially amongst the young, through the help of the Church School in Adelaide. His Eminence also distributed many resources to the community including books and pamphlets that the Archdiocese had organised and made.
On Saturday evening the community gathered for vespers prayers and on Sunday morning, Matins and Liturgy were held. Afterwards, a fellowship with the community was organised, which gave a chance for His Eminence to meet more people and offer his pastoral care where needed.
The Sunday School children beautifully chanted the Apolytikion of St Elias, which H.E was very pleased to hear and afterwards a cake was cut along with the kids, in remembrance of the feast of the great Prophet Elias.
